Job DescriptionUnitek College has an open position for an Admissions Representative to work at our beautiful campus in Fremont.
Unitek-Fremont offers diploma level programs in Vocational Nursing and Medical Assisting. Our online catalog includes Associates in Nursing(Bridge) and Medical Office Administration. The Admissions department follows a consultative sales process with prospective students. This is a very metric driven role and is not administrative.
Job responsibilities include:
- Respond to inquiries from potential students
- Make 100 - 150 outbound phone calls per day to potential students to gauge interest and schedule interviews.
- Present career planning options for potential students during in-person or virtual interview sessions.
- Follow up with interested students to answer questions and collect admissions documents.
- Document contact with students in student information database (Nexus/Campus Vue).
